The cheapest times to fly from ATL to NUE are
- January 8th to March 25th
- August 13th to December 9th (except the weeks of September 17th and November 19th)
based on data collected exclusively by Champion Traveler across tens of millions of flights. Among all the dates above, the very cheapest time to fly from ATL to NUE is late October. Prices can be as high as $1872 for Sunday flights during late July, or as low as $703 for Tuesday flights around late October.
When to Fly to Nuremberg
Flying from Atlanta, GA (ATL) to Nuremberg (NUE) will usually cost between $811 to $1724 per person if booking more than four weeks in advance. On average the very cheapest time to fly is late October with an average ticket price of $809. Due to high demand the most expensive time to fly is late July, with an average price of $1682. Planning your trip to low-cost times can easily save you $873 on economy flights and even more on first-class flights. Generally, any price below $1075 can be considered a good price for a round-trip ATL to NUE flight.

Flight Prices by Day of the Week
Tuesday is usually the cheapest day to fly to NUE, and Wednesday the cheapest day to fly back into ATL. Sundays are the most expensive days to fly to Nuremberg, and Saturdays are the most expensive days to return to Atlanta. Selecting flights on the least expensive days could save you up to $99 (8%) on this flight.
Departing prices are for round-trip flights returning on the day of departure. For example, a flight departing on Tuesday and returning a week later will cost an average of $1182. Nonstop Flights and Layovers
Travelers looking to fly from ATL to NUE can generally find a 1-layover flight. Because there is not usually a direct flight option the real-world direct flight time of 9 hour 29 minutes may not be realistic.

Which airlines fly this route?
You can find 16 major airlines flying this route most often: Aeromexico, Air Canada, Air France, American, Austrian, Brussels Airlines, Delta, Iberia, KLM, LOT, Lufthansa, Singapore Airlines, SWISS, Tap Air Portugal, Turkish Airlines, United, and potentially more during busy seasons.
How far away is it from Nuernberg Airport to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port?
The distance between the two airports is roughly 4720 miles or 7596 kilometers.
How long does it take to fly from ATL to NUE?
The real-world flight time for a nonstop ATL to NUE flight is about 9 hour 29 minutes.
How many flights go between Atlanta, GA and Nuremberg?
It depends on the day of the week and the date, but a typical day might have around 43 available flights from ATL to NUE.
